According to sources, Note manufactures circuit boards for products that must withstand tough environments with vibrations, temperature differences, and moisture. A large part of Note's production goes to the defense industry, though the specific products or clients it supplies are not detailed. Karin Nichols, CEO of Note Torsby, explained the company's role, stating, "We manufacture electronics for environments where it would not normally survive.
" The company is currently moving into completely new premises, next to the old factory south of Torsby. The move involves a doubling of the premises, but the exact size or capacity compared to the old facility is unknown.
